    Willingness to pay. If people are willing to use Astra instead of Sol even if it costs twice as much, OpenAI has no need to make it cheaper. Prices only reflect costs in a competitive market where customers actively seek out cheaper alternatives.

        costs are in a large part tied to model parameter count, eg. a small model fits on one GPU, the biggest models require an entire rack

        the primary difference you see through those prices is model size

        that you don't seem much capability difference is why Big Ai is pushing for regulatory capture, because small models are nearly as good for many tasks at a fraction of the cost, undermining the business model they have used to justify the most expensive infra build out in human history

            Also I think there are diminishing returns to larger models and the harness can make up for some weaknesses. Like maybe the huge model can hypothetically answer a question off the cuff but the small model can get some search results and think about those and give you an answer.
